<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">/*å¼•å…¥iconfontå›¾æ&nbsp;‡*/
.icon {
   width: 1em; height: 1em;
   vertical-align: -0.15em;
   fill: currentColor;
   overflow: hidden;
}
.wrapper{
    width: 1400px;
    margin: 0 auto;
}
.container-fluid{width:100%;}
a{color: #333;}
a:hover,a:active,a:visited{text-decoration:none;}
.head{height:32px; background:#f4f5f7;}
.head div{line-height:32px;font-size:16px;color:#333;}
.head .icon{font-size:18px;color:#d61518;margin-right:5px;}

.navbar{margin-bottom:0;border:0;border-bottom:1px #e7e7e7 solid;}
.navbar-brand,.logo .container-fluid{display: flex; justify-content:space-between; align-items: center;}
.logo .container-fluid::before,.logo .container-fluid::after,.container-fluid::before,.container-fluid::after{display:none;}
.navbar-brand span{height: 3rem; line-height: 3rem; margin-left: 1rem; padding-left: 1rem;border-left: 1px solid #fff; color: #fff;}
.navbar-default .navbar-nav&gt;li&gt;a{color: #fff;overflow: hidden;}
.navbar-default .navbar-nav&gt;.active&gt;a, .navbar-default .navbar-nav&gt;.active&gt;a:focus, .navbar-default .navbar-nav&gt;.active&gt;a:hover,.navbar-default .navbar-nav&gt;.open&gt;a,.navbar-default .navbar-nav&gt;li&gt;a:hover{color: #fff; background-color: rgba(255,255,255,.6);}
.navbar-default .navbar-nav&gt;.open&gt;a:focus, .navbar-default .navbar-nav&gt;.open&gt;a:hover,.dropdown-menu&gt;li a:hover{color: #000; background-color:#fff;}
.header-right{width:620px;display:flex; justify-content:space-between;align-items:center;}
.tel{font-size:30px; color:#d61518;}
.search{width:330px;display:flex;justify-content:center;flex-wrap:nowrap;}
.search input{float:left;width:260px;height:42px;line-height:42px;padding:10px;border:#d61518 2px solid;}
.search button{width:60px;height:42px;line-height:42px;font-size:26px;color:#fff;border:#d61518 2px solid;background:#d61518;}

.baokao{display:flex;justify-content:space-between;align-items:center;flex-wrap:wrap;}
.baokao a {  padding:0 15px;  height: 40px;  color:#333;  background-color: rgba(242, 244, 245, 0.92);  border-radius: 6px;  font-size: 16px;  line-height: 40px;  text-align: center;
  position: relative;  margin-bottom:15px;}
.baokao a::after {  display: block;  content: '';  position: absolute;  width: 2px;  height: 18px;  background: #ffffff;  transform: rotate(-45deg);  right: -6px;  bottom: -14px;
  -ms-transition: all 0.4s;  -moz-transition: all 0.4s;  -webkit-transition: all 0.4s;  -o-transition: all 0.4s;  transition: all 0.4s;}
.baokao a:hover {  text-decoration: none;  font-weight: bold;  color: #ffffff;  background: url(../images/subnav-hover.png) no-repeat center center;  background-size: 100% 100%;}
.baokao a:hover::after {  -ms-transform: rotate(-45deg) translateY(-12px);  -moz-transform: rotate(-45deg) translateY(-12px);  -webkit-transform: rotate(-45deg) translateY(-12px);
  -o-transform: rotate(-45deg) translateY(-12px);  transform: rotate(-45deg) translateY(-12px);}
/**banner**/
.slideBox{position:relative;}
.slideBox .hd{width:100%; height:15px; overflow:hidden; position:absolute; left:0; bottom:10px; z-index:1; }
.slideBox .hd ul{margin:0; padding:0; overflow:hidden; zoom:1; text-align:center;}
.slideBox .hd ul li{list-style:none;display:inline-block; margin:0 10px;  width:14px; height:14px; line-height:14px; border-radius:7px; text-align:center; background:#fff; cursor:pointer; }
.slideBox .hd ul li.on{ background:#f00; color:#fff; }
.slideBox .bd ul{margin:0;padding:0; z-index:0;   }
.slideBox .bd li{list-style:none; zoom:1; vertical-align:middle; }
.slideBox .bd img{ width:100%; height:auto; display:block;  }

.one{padding-top:20px;background:#fff;}
.mb20{margin-bottom:20px;}
.login{min-height:300px;padding:20px 30px 108px 30px;border:#ddd 2px solid;border-radius:8px;background:url(../images/login.jpg) center bottom no-repeat;}
.login h3{margin-bottom:20px;text-align:center;font-size:19px;font-weight:600;color:#dc0000;}
.login .form-control{border-radius:17px;background:#f6f2f2;margin-bottom:20px;}
.relative{position:relative;}
#yzm{position:absolute;right:2px; top:2px; display:block; width:90px;height:30px;line-height:30px;text-align:center;border-radius:15px;color:#fff; background:#e02727;cursor:pointer;}
.btn-fluid{width:100%;border-radius:17px;}
.userinfo{text-align: center;font-size: 15px;}
.userinfo img{width:80px;height:80px;border-radius: 40px;margin-bottom: 15px;}
.picScrollbox{padding:10px; max-height:345px; border:1px solid #ccc;}
.picScroll-left{overflow:hidden; position:relative;  }
.picScroll-left .hd{overflow:hidden; height:20px; position:absolute; right:10px; bottom:15px; z-index:9999;}
.picScroll-left .hd ul{ overflow:hidden; zoom:1; margin-top:10px; zoom:1; }
.picScroll-left .hd ul li{float:left;width:10px; height:10px; overflow:hidden; border-radius:50%; margin-right:5px; text-indent:-999px; cursor:pointer; background:#fff; }
.picScroll-left .hd ul li.on{background:#dc0000;}
.picScroll-left .bd ul{ overflow:hidden; zoom:1;}
.picScroll-left .bd ul li{margin:0 8px; position:relative; float:left; _display:inline; overflow:hidden; text-align:center;}
.picScroll-left .bd ul li .pic{ text-align:center; }
.picScroll-left .bd ul li .pic img{ width:545px; height:325px; display:block; }
.picScroll-left .bd ul li:hover .pic img {border-color:#dc0000;}
.picScroll-left .bd ul li .title{ width:100%; height:40px; line-height:40px; overflow:hidden; position:absolute; left:0; bottom:0; font-size:14px; text-align:left; text-indent:20px; color:#fff; background:rgba(0,0,0,.6);}
.picScroll-left .bd ul li .title a{color:#fff;}

.slideTxtBox{ width:100%; }
.slideTxtBox .hd,.mtitle{ height:44px; line-height:44px; border-bottom:2px solid #ddd; margin-bottom:15px; }
.slideTxtBox .hd ul{ padding:0 0 0 20px; }
.slideTxtBox .hd ul li{padding:0; list-style:none; display:inline; float:left; width:110px; font-size:22px; font-weight:600; color:#040404; text-align:center; cursor:pointer; position:relative; }
.slideTxtBox .hd ul li.on{ color:#dc0000;}
.slideTxtBox .hd ul li.on::after,.mtitle span::after{content:"";position:absolute;left:0;top:42px;width:100%;height:10px; border-top:2px solid #dc0000; background:url(../images/xsj.png) center top no-repeat;}
.slideTxtBox .bd ul{ padding:0 5px;  zoom:1;  position:relative;}
.slideTxtBox .bd ul .more{position:absolute; top:-45px; right:10px;font-size:18px;color:#6f6f6f;}
.slideTxtBox .bd li{list-style:none; height:40px; line-height:40px; font-size:17px; overflow:hidden;}
.slideTxtBox .bd li::before{content:"â€¢"; margin-right:10px; color:#333; font-size:16px; font-weight:600;}
.slideTxtBox .bd li a{color:#333;}
.slideTxtBox .bd li:hover::before{color:#e02727;}
.slideTxtBox .bd li:hover a,.slideTxtBox .bd li a:hover{color:#e02727;}
.slideTxtBox .bd li .date{ float:right; margin-left: 10px; color:#999;}
.slideTxtBox .bd li:hover .date{color:#e02727;}
.sliderBox ul{padding-left:0;}
.gallery-thumbs{width:100%;background:#eff1f4;overflow:hidden;}
.gallery-top{width:100%;overflow:hidden;}
.mtitle span{display:block;padding:0 20px;margin-left:20px;float:left;font-size:22px; font-weight:600; color:#040404;position:relative;}
.mtitle a{float:right; margin-right:10px; font-size:17px; color:#6f6f6f;}

.kclist{display:flex;padding:0;justify-content:flex-start;align-items:flex-start;flex-wrap:wrap;}
.kclist li{list-style:none;/*width:30%;*/margin:10px 0 20px;}
.kclist li .imgbox {position: relative; width: 100%; height: 0; padding-top: 75%; margin-bottom:20px;}
.kclist li .imgbox img {position: absolute; top: 0;left: 0; width: 100%; height: 100%;}
.kclist li p{font-size:17px;height:20px;line-height:20px;display:flex;justify-content:space-between;align-items:center;}
.kclist li p .new{width:20px;height:20px;padding:0 3px;text-align:center;font-size:14px;margin-right:15px; color:#fff;border-radius:3px;background:#fda11e;}
.kclist li p .title{color:#333; flex-wrap:nowrap;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;flex: 1 1 auto;}
.kclist li p .price{font-weight:600; color:#ff000f;margin-left:10px;}
		
.rl{width:170px; padding-top:55px; background:url(../images/rl.jpg) left top no-repeat;}
.day{padding-right:52px;margin-bottom:20px;font-size:53px;font-weight:600;font-family:'é»‘ä½“';text-align:center;color:#e14240;}
.rl p{height:30px;line-height:30px;font-size:20px;color:#000;text-align:left;overflow:hidden;}
.rl:last-child{margin-right:0;}

.two{padding:35px 0;background:url(../images/two.jpg) center top no-repeat;}
.tt{margin:20px 0; height:90px;overflow:hidden;}
.tt img{float:left;margin-right:15px;}
.tt p{height:50px;font-size:16px;line-height:25px;margin-bottom:8px;overflow:hidden;}.tt p a{color:#333;}
.tt .xq{display:inline-block;width:80px;height:30px;line-height:30px;text-align:center;border:#dc0000 1px solid;color:#dc0000;border-radius:15px;}
.ksnews{padding-left:0;}
.ksnews li{list-style:none;margin:10px 0;font-size:16px; line-height:30px; display:flex;justify-content:space-between;align-items:center;flex-wrap:nowrap;}
.ksnews .cate{display:block; width:76px; flex: 0 0 76px;height:26px;line-height:26px; margin-right:10px;text-align:center;font-size:15px; border-radius:15px; color:#fff; background:#c4c8d1;}
.ksnews li:nth-child(1) .cate{background:#dc0000;}
.ksnews li:nth-child(2) .cate{background:#fa7744;}
.ksnews li:nth-child(3) .cate{background:#fac944;}
.ksnews a{display:block;flex: 1 1 auto;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;color:#333;}
.ksnews .time{width:50px;flex: 0 0 50px; margin-left:10px; color:#999;}

.bmlist,.yxlink{padding-left:0;}
.bmlist li,.yxlink li{list-style:none;margin:10px auto 20px;}
.yxlink li{padding:2px; border:#eee 1px solid;}

.link{padding:20px 0;background:#e4e7ec;}
.link .wrapper{display:flex;justify-content:flex-start;align-items:center;flex-wrap:wrap;}
.foot{padding:30px 0;font-size:14px; line-height:20px; text-align:center; color:#fff; background:#282728;}
.foot .wrapper{display:flex;justify-content:space-between;align-items:center;margin-bottom:20px;}
.foot a{color:#fff;}

.rightside{position:fixed; right: 10px; top:0;  z-index: 99999; border-radius:8px; transform: translateY(300px);}
.rightside .floor { border-bottom: 1px solid #f2f2f2;    position: relative;    box-sizing: border-box;}
.rightside .floor &gt; a { display:block; width: 60px;  height: 60px; z-index: 9999; font-size:12px; color:#333; text-align:center;  background:#fff; }
.rightside .floor &gt; a .icon{margin:5px auto;font-size:20px; color:#d61518;}
.rightside .floor .absbox {padding:0 10px;  position: absolute; right: 61px; top: 0; background:#fff; z-index: 3;}
.rightside .floor .kftel{height:60px;line-height:60px;}
.rightside .floor &gt; div {transform: translateX(300px);}
.rightside .floor &gt; div p{font-size:14px; color:#333;}
.rightside .floor .kftel p{width:140px;text-align:center;font-size:15px; font-weight:600;}
.rightside .floor:hover div { transition: all 300ms linear;    transform: translateX(0);}
.rightside .floor .back { box-shadow: 0 0 15px #e4e4e4;  height: 50px;    width: 120px;   display: flex;  align-items: center;  justify-content: center;  font-size: 12px;  color: #666;  box-sizing: border-box;}

/*è¶…å°å±å¹•*/
@media (max-width: 400px) {
	
}

/* å°å±å¹•ï¼ˆæ‰‹æœºï¼Œå°äºŽç­‰äºŽ 768pxï¼‰ */
@media (max-width: 768px) {
	.wrapper{width:100%;}
	.row{margin-left: 0;margin-right: 0;}
	.container-fluid&gt;.navbar-header{margin-left:0;}
	.navbar-default{position:relative; background:#fff;}
	.navbar-header{width:96%; display: flex; justify-content:space-between; align-items: center;}
	.navbar-header::before,.navbar-header::after{display:none;}
	.navbar-toggle{margin-right:0;}
	.navbar-brand{padding: 5px 10px; height: 50px;}
	.navbar-brand img{height: 40px;}
	.navbar-collapse{position:absolute;left:0;width:100%;height:100vh;z-index:999;background:#fff;}
	.navbar-nav li{border-bottom:#efefef 1px solid;}
	.navbar-default .navbar-nav&gt;li&gt;a{font-size:16px; color:#d61518;}
	.container-fluid{padding:0;}
	
	.flex{display: flex; justify-content:space-around; align-items: center; background:#eff1f4;}
	.gallery-thumbs{padding-left:0;width:80%;height:40px;}
	.swiper-button-next{width:30px;height:40px;line-height:40px;font-size:30px;color:#999;position:absolute;left:0;top:0;}
	.swiper-button-prev{width:30px;height:40px;line-height:40px;font-size:30px;color:#999;position:absolute;right:0;top:0;}
	.gallery-thumbs .swiper-slide{width:auto;list-style:none;font-size:17px;line-height:40px;margin:0 20px;}
	.gallery-thumbs .swiper-slide .icon{font-size:20px;margin-right:10px;}
	.gallery-thumbs .swiper-slide-thumb-active{color:#ff000f;}
	/*.kclist li{width:48%;}*/
	.rlbox{display: flex; justify-content:space-around; align-items: center;flex-wrap:wrap;}
	
	.two{padding-bottom:0;}
	.bmlist{display:flex; justify-content:space-between; align-items:top; flex-wrap:wrap;}
	.bmlist li{width:48%;}
	.bmlist li img{width:100%;}
	.yxlink{display:flex; justify-content:space-around; align-items:center; flex-wrap:wrap;}
	.yxlink li{margin-bottom:0px;}
	.yxlink li img{height:30px;width:auto;}
	
	.link .menu{width:100%;font-size:18px;line-height:30px; border-bottom:#c7c7c7 1px solid;margin-bottom:10px; text-indent:20px;}
	.link ul{padding:0;}
	.link ul li{list-style:none; display:inline-block; margin:0 10px 10px;font-size:15px;}
	.link ul li a{color:#0e050a;}
	.foot{padding:15px 0;}
	.foot .wrapper{border-bottom:#9c9c9c 1px solid;padding-bottom:10px;}
	.foot .fnav{width:100%;display:flex; justify-content:space-between;}
	.foot .fnav .lieb{width:33%;}
	.lieb h3{font-size:20px;font-weight:600;margin-bottom:20px;}
	.lieb p{font-size:14px;margin-bottom:20px;}
	.lieb a{color:#fff;}

}

/* å°å±å¹•ï¼ˆå¹³æ¿ï¼Œå¤§äºŽç­‰äºŽ 768pxï¼‰ */
@media (min-width: 768px) { 
	.navbar-default{background: none;border: 0;}
	.navbar-brand{padding: 10px; height: 60px;}
	.collapse{width:100%;padding:0;}
	.navcat{padding-left:0;padding-right:0;margin-bottom:20px;background:#dc0000;}
	.navbar-nav{width:100%;display:flex;justify-content:space-between;align-items:center;}
	.navbar-nav li a{font-size:18px; color:#fff;}
	.head,.navcat,#banner,.two,.link,.foot{min-width:1400px;}
	
	.link .menu{width:100%;font-size:18px;line-height:30px; border-bottom:#c7c7c7 1px solid;margin-bottom:10px;}
	.link ul li{list-style:none; display:inline-block; margin:0 20px 10px 0;font-size:17px;}
	.link ul li a{color:#0e050a;}
	.foot .wrapper{border-bottom:#9c9c9c 1px solid;padding-bottom:30px;}
	.foot .fnav{width:700px;display:flex; justify-content:space-between;border-right:#9c9c9c 1px solid;}
	.foot .fnav .lieb{width:33%;}
	.lieb h3{font-size:25px;font-weight:600;margin-bottom:20px;}
	.lieb p{font-size:14px;margin-bottom:20px;}
	.lieb a{color:#fff;}
	.ewm{width:660px;display:flex; justify-content:space-between; align-items:center; text-align:center; color:#fff;}
	.ewm img{margin-bottom:10px;}
	.one{padding-top:30px;}
	.gallery-thumbs{max-width:340px;padding:15px 0;}
	.gallery-thumbs .swiper-wrapper{flex-wrap:wrap;padding-left:0;}
	.gallery-thumbs .swiper-slide{list-style:none; width:100%;height:53px;line-height:53px;text-indent:50px;font-size:20px;margin-bottom:20px;cursor:pointer;}
	.gallery-thumbs .swiper-slide:last-child{margin-bottom:0;}
	.gallery-thumbs .swiper-slide .icon{margin-right:10px;color:#d61518;}
	.gallery-thumbs .on{position:relative;color:#fff; background:#d00606;}
	.gallery-thumbs .on::before{position:absolute;left:-6px;top:0;content:'';width:6px; height:59px;background:url(../images/g.jpg) right top no-repeat;}
	.gallery-thumbs .on::after{position:absolute;right:-27px;top:0;content:'';width:27px;height:53px;background:url(../images/r.jpg) left top no-repeat;}
	.gallery-thumbs .on .icon{color:#fff;}
	.rl{float:left; margin:10px 63px 20px 0;}
	.bmlist li{width:325px;float:left;margin-right:13px;overflow:hidden;}
	.bmlist li:last-child{margin-right:0;}
	.yxlink li{float:left;margin-right:20px;}
	.yxlink li img{height:74px;width:auto;}
}

/* ä¸­ç­‰å±å¹•ï¼ˆæ¡Œé¢æ˜¾ç¤ºå™¨ï¼Œå¤§äºŽç­‰äºŽ 992pxï¼‰ */
@media (min-width: 992px) { 
	.navbar-brand{width:700px; height:102px; }
	.navbar-brand span{font-size: 1.5rem;}
	.logo .container-fluid{padding:0;}
	.one{padding-top:40px;}
	.link .menu{width:125px;height:52px;font-size:25px;line-height:52px; border-bottom:0; border-right:#c7c7c7 3px solid;}
}</pre></body></html>